Why Businesses Need Outside General Counsel
In the modern corporate environment, the requirement for outside general counsel has grown progressively vital for organizations searching for legal expertise without the overhead of a full-time in-house team. Businesses often face a wide range of legal challenges, including compliance issues, contract negotiations, and risk management. Leveraging outside general counsel allows companies to access experienced legal professionals who can deliver customized advice and strategies to navigate these complexities.
In addition, outside counsel can accommodate shifting legal needs, delivering flexibility that an in-house team may not. This arrangement also allows organizations to gain from diverse perspectives and specialized knowledge, strengthening their capacity to address sector-specific legal concerns. Additionally, outside general counsel can help mitigate potential legal risks by confirming that businesses continue to be compliant with continuously developing regulations. Finally, the integration of outside counsel into business operations can produce more informed decision-making and a stronger legal foundation.

How Outside Counsel Enhances Risk Management
While working through the complexities of legal compliance, companies gain from the expertise of outside counsel in bolstering their risk management strategies. Outside general counsel bring a wealth of experience in detecting potential legal pitfalls and developing tailored strategies to mitigate these risks. Their objective perspective enables a comprehensive assessment of a company's legal landscape, which can often be disregarded by internal teams.
Moreover, outside counsel can implement proactive measures to deal with compliance issues before they escalate into costly disputes. By staying updated on evolving laws and regulations, they make certain that businesses remain compliant, minimizing the likelihood of legal challenges.
Beyond providing legal advice, outside counsel regularly organize training sessions for employees, cultivating a culture of compliance and awareness within the organization. This comprehensive approach not only shields the business but also bolsters its reputation, ultimately contributing to long-term success and stability.

Common Questions
How Do I Select the Right Outside General Counsel for My Business?
To select the right outside general counsel, businesses should assess expertise, industry experience, communication skills, and alignment with company values. Obtaining testimonials and conducting interviews can further ensure a suitable fit for their legal needs.
Which Industries Gain the Most from Hiring Outside General Counsel?
Industries such as technology, healthcare, finance, and manufacturing often benefit most from bringing on outside general counsel. These industries regularly deal with complex regulations, requiring specialized legal expertise to handle compliance and reduce risk exposure effectively.
Can Outside General Counsel Provide Representation for My Business in Court?
Third-party general counsel can serve a business in court, assuming they possess the required qualifications and licenses. Their knowledge supports successful legal approaches, guaranteeing that the business's interests are effectively represented during litigation matters.
How Do Outside General Counsel Manage Conflicts of Interest?
External legal counsel address conflicts of interest by conducting detailed assessments, putting in place policies to detect potential issues, and maintaining transparency with clients. They frequently disclose any conflicts and may step away from representation if required.
What's the Typical Contract Duration When Engaging Outside General Counsel?
The typical contract length with outside general counsel typically ranges from one to three years. These agreements often include renewal options and are tailored to fulfill the particular needs and circumstances of the business involved.
